Handover: fan-out backpressure (Pellwright Notify). The dispatcher now sheds load when the downstream buffer passes 80%; shed events go to the deferred topic and replay automatically within ten minutes. Don't raise the buffer ceiling — it masks slow consumers. Metrics live on the fan-out dashboard; alert thresholds are tuned, leave them. The replay controller runs under a locked-down account; if it ever needs recovery, the wizard asks for a recovery passphrase, which I've left on the line below this note.

unlock words, yawig-kagef: gordor-holvan-ulaael-pramir-ulaiel-tamdor

## v2.14.3

Fixed intermittent DNS resolution failures in the Quillgate edge proxy. Root cause was a stale resolver cache that ignored TTLs under load; we now respect upstream TTLs and added a fallback resolver. No config changes required. Questions about this fix should go to the engineer responsible, listed below.

named custodian: Zorok Briir Novvan

Handover: Britta → Soren, image slimming for the Fernhollow plugin runtime. I moved the base image to a distroless build and trimmed roughly 400 MB; external plugin authors must now declare native deps explicitly in the manifest, since the shell tooling is gone. Remaining task: prune the debug layer. The slimming pipeline's signing vault opens with the passphrase below.

unlock words, fafop-hawep: briwyn-oliix-sorox

**Autocomplete feels sluggish**

Welcome aboard! If Quickfetch suggestions take more than ~300ms, the Trigramix index probably missed its nightly compaction. Check the compactor logs first — a stuck shard is the usual culprit. You can trigger a manual compaction through the ops endpoint, which needs auth, so use the token below.

session JWT of yawep-yawep = eyJhbGciOiJIUzI1NiIsInR5cCI6IkpXVCJ9.eyJzdWIiOiI3pWF3_In0.aXYsHiog

Subject: Quickstore 4.2 — bloom filter now fronts the KV layer

Plugin authors: starting with this release, Quickstore places a bloom filter ahead of the key-value store. Negative lookups return faster; false positives fall through safely. No API changes are required on your side. Verify your plugin against the staging build referenced below.

session token of fahif-tadup = htk3_9c7